Explosion Claims Lives in Kabul’s Secure Shahr-e-Naw Area
An explosion occurred in the Shahr-e-Naw neighbourhood of Kabul, Afghanistan, on Saturday, reportedly claiming the lives of at least seven individuals. The blast took place in a restaurant located in one of the city’s perceived secure areas, highlighting ongoing security challenges in the capital city.
The incident is one of the deadliest attacks to strike Kabul in recent times. Eyewitnesses described a chaotic scene, with people rushing to help the injured in the aftermath of the explosion. The authorities are yet to provide detailed information regarding the exact circumstances of the attack, including any potential motives or suspects behind this incident.
According to the Taliban’s Ministry of Interior, investigations are currently under way. A spokesperson asserted that the attack targeted civilians, expressing condolences to the families of the victims.
Kabul has witnessed sporadic violence since the Taliban regained control in August 2021, despite claims of improved security. The Shahr-e-Naw area, once considered relatively safe, is home to several restaurants and cafes, often frequented by residents and foreigners.
Local sources suggest that the target may have been a gathering associated with a particular group or event. However, no group has immediately claimed responsibility for the attack as of this report.
This incident occurs amidst a broader climate of fear among Afghan citizens regarding their safety. Many remain apprehensive about public gatherings due to the potential for violence, which has become increasingly common.
“Our thoughts are with the victims and their families,” said one community leader. “This violence must end, and we need peace to rebuild our lives.” The international community continues to monitor the situation closely, urging the Taliban to ensure the safety of its citizens and uphold its commitments to peace.
As the investigation progresses, security forces have increased patrols in Kabul, aiming to reassure the public and prevent further occurrences of such violent acts. Meanwhile, residents express their concerns, fearing that such incidents could escalate and further destabilise the city.
The local government is expected to release more details in the coming days as they navigate the challenges of maintaining order in a complex and changing security environment. The stability of Kabul remains a priority for both its citizens and the governing authorities.
